Before we get into the download details, it's important to understand the weight this album carries. Following the monumental success of Tha Carter III , Wayne faced immense pressure. He didn't just meet expectations; he smashed them. In its first week, Tha Carter IV sold a staggering 964,000 copies, debuting at #1. The album's sound is a direct continuation of the playful yet aggressive style Wayne perfected on Tha Carter III . It is a "grab bag" of hard-hitting rap anthems and surprising pop-rap crossovers. Rather than abandoning the experimental rock elements of his Rebirth album, Wayne blended them with the punchline-heavy, Southern hip-hop that his fans craved.
